Develop and Validate the Jump-Up-Landing error scoring system for jump-up-landing biomechanics.

简要总结

The commonest injuries in sports are musculoskeletal injuries comprising 80% of injuries in sports. Lower extremity movement patterns influence the load and deformational forces on ligaments. This study incorporates the Landing Error Scoring System (LESS) as a tool for assessing jump-landing mechanics; however, a significant limitation of this scoring pattern is its exclusive focus on the landing component. To address this gap, we propose the development of a new scoring system: the Jump Landing Error Scoring System (JLESS). This innovative framework will evaluate athletes not only during the landing phase but also during the jump-up phase, providing a comprehensive assessment of their movement patterns. The jump-landing biomechanics in which lower extremity control, trunk control, symmetry of lower extremity landing, psychological component, knee impact, eccentric working of quads gluteus maximus with stability of hip and knee. To lift the body against gravity to generate the explosive power for quality landing and to dampen the forces when jumping. The parameters which will evaluate a proper jump up characteristics will be included on the bases of the foot angulations, knee initial contact or stance of jump up, hip angulations, symmetry of knee for landing on the box, trunk flexion or extension, maintaining the posture and balance, readiness of the patient (psychological factors).To assess these parameters and make the test more demanding, jump up and landing on the box is more difficult as compare to jumping down from the box. Hence, it was preferred to identify the jump mechanics and its differences from LESS.

入选标准

  • Fit athletes dominantly playing lower extremity sports.
  • Amateur sportsmen/fitness trainers having no history of old injury to lower extremity.
  • Athletes with history of lower extremity injury who underwent physio rehab for minimum 24 weeks and not more than 40 weeks.
  • Amateur sportsmen or trainers with history of injury to lower extremity but did not limit herself or himself to play their regular sports specialty.

排除标准

  • Athletes having history of ankle injury or ankle fractures.
  • Calcaneal spur.
  • Fracture of spine or spinal injuries.
  • Disc spondylosis or cervical spondylosis.
  • Hair line fracture, recent knee surgeries or hip surgeries.
